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
52 405573 730864 330370
76221 804687895
76221 804687895
439030146 4032 32078 16
All about undefined
Interested in learning more?
76221 804687895
439030146 4032 32078 16
See more
9413762009 49504844398
165183461 64075366 16877674
See more
560260 2129 8624
8003016724 44620685 28
See more